To check your return period on Amazon, follow these simple steps: First, go to the 'Your Orders' section in your Amazon account. Find the order you're considering returning and look at the 'Return or Replace Items' option. If your item is eligible for return, you will see the last date to initiate a return. This timeframe is typically 30 days from receiving your order, but can vary based on the type of product and seller. This lets you know by when you need to start the return process to be eligible.

  1. How long is the return period on Amazon? The return period on Amazon is typically 30 days from the date you receive your order, but it can vary depending on the product type and seller.
  2. Where do I find the return eligibility on Amazon? You can find return eligibility in the 'Your Orders' section under the 'Return or Replace Items' option for each order.
  3. Can the Amazon return period vary by product? Yes, some products and sellers may have different return timeframes, so it’s important to check the specific return deadline for each order.
